What is unfollow in SAP LOD-CRM-SOD - Sales OnDemand?


SAP Term: unfollow

  • Component: LOD-CRM-SOD

  • Component Name: Sales OnDemand

  • Description: To unsubscribe from an information source so that it no longer appears as a source and its updates no longer appear in a feed.
